Survey and Form Settings
We provide a number of settings to improve not only your survey building experience but also participants’ completion process.
Open a project and select Settings in the left-hand toolbar of the builder. Settings are grouped into five collapsible sections — click a section heading to expand it:

Appearance
Section titled “Appearance”Remove branding: By default, all projects contain our branding. Enabling this (also called White label) will remove this branding from surveys, quizzes and emails.
Show progress bar: Show or hide the progress bar at the top of your form, and choose its position style (e.g. Compact). Toggled on by default.
Highlight next question (auto-scroll): Automatically scrolls to and highlights the next question to be answered. Toggled on by default.
Automatic Numbering: Gives questions numbers automatically. Toggled on by default. You can also toggle numbering for individual questions — for more on this see our guide to the Question Quick Menu.
Privacy & Security
Section titled “Privacy & Security”Pseudonymization: This feature allows you to separate personally identifiable information (PII) from survey/quiz/form responses in your results. Allowing for complete anonymity of responses, whilst retaining a list.
Password Protection: Require participants to enter a password before they can complete your project. Enter your chosen password directly into the Password field in this section — leave it blank if you don’t want a password.
- How to Set a Password for your project
Prevent Duplicate Responses: This option limits the number of responses per computer to one, using cookies.
Cookies are packets of data sent to a browser by an internet server. Each time that user accesses the same server they are identified or tracked.
Preventing duplicate responses will stop the same respondent from completing your project more than once, therefore sustaining the integrity of your results.
Language
Section titled “Language”Built-in survey messages (Next Page, Finish Survey, error and validation text, and so on) now automatically display in the participant’s language across 54 languages — no further configuration is required.
Completion & Notifications
Section titled “Completion & Notifications”Edit After Completed: When using the Tracking feature, you can use this setting to allow respondents to edit their responses once they have submitted their completed response.
If a participant feels they have made a mistake, provided incorrect information, or have simply changed their opinion concerning a subject, this option is a useful way to sanction some flexibility in changing their answer choices.
Email Notifications: Receive an instant email notification when a new response is submitted to your form.
Create Inbox Conversation: Automatically creates a conversation in your Inbox when a response is submitted. Requires a Contact email address question in the form. Toggled on by default.
Contact Saving
Section titled “Contact Saving”Contacts collected from this form can be saved to your contact list automatically — pick one or more Groups to add respondents to. Once in a group, you can email them, pre-fill or update their details, record GDPR consents, and collect e-signatures. To keep a form for responses-only, leave all groups unselected.
